摘要
选用 C-十一烷基间苯二酚杯 ( 4)芳烃作为主体分子 ,将其修饰在玻碳电极上 ,制成了一种主客体化学传感器 ,对溶液中的客体分子——对苯二酚进行了测定 .该电极具有良好的选择性 ,对 5 .0× 10 - 5 ~ 1.5× 10 - 3m ol/ L 的对苯二酚具有很好的线性响应 ,检测下限为 2 .5× 10 - 5 m ol/ L.同时 。
Calixarenes are a kind of host molecular with excellent selectivity. C undecylcalix(4) resorcinarene was chosen to modify on the glass carbon electrode to develop a host guest chemistry modified electrode, which is used to determinate the guest molecular hydroquinone in the solution. The modified electrode has better selectivity. The line range is 5.0×10 -5 ~1.5×10 -3 mol/L and the detection limit is 2.5×10 -5 mol/L. The surface state of glass carbon electrode is also investigated before and after modification.
